Factors That Affect New Garage Door Cost

The new garage door cost depends on a combination of factors, ranging from the type of door to additional accessories like insulation or windows. Understanding these factors will help you choose the right door for your needs and budget.

Type of Garage Door

Garage doors come in various types, and the type you choose significantly impacts the overall cost. The most common types of garage doors include:

  • Single Panel Garage Doors: These are a single, solid piece that tilts up and slides overhead when opened. They are often more affordable but may require more maintenance.

  • Sectional Garage Doors: These are the most popular option and consist of several horizontal panels connected by hinges. They roll up and down smoothly and tend to be more durable than single-panel doors.

  • Roll-Up Garage Doors: Ideal for commercial use or homeowners who need a durable, space-saving option, roll-up doors are made of slats that roll into a compact coil when opened. These are generally more expensive than traditional doors.

  • Carriage Garage Doors: Known for their aesthetic appeal, carriage doors open outward and resemble traditional barn doors. These can be customized with various materials and finishes, making them more expensive.

Material of the Garage Door

The material you choose for your garage door is another key determinant of the new garage door cost. Each material has different benefits and price points, and the decision often comes down to factors such as durability, maintenance, and appearance.

Steel Garage Doors

Steel garage doors are among the most popular choices due to their durability, strength, and low maintenance. They can also be insulated for better energy efficiency. Steel doors tend to range in price from $500 to $2,500, depending on thickness and insulation options.

Wood Garage Doors

Wood garage doors provide a classic, natural look and can be customized with various designs and finishes. However, they require more maintenance, including regular painting or staining, to protect against moisture and rot. Prices for wood doors range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more, depending on the type of wood and level of customization.

Aluminum Garage Doors

Aluminum doors are lightweight and rust-resistant, making them a good option for homeowners in areas prone to moisture. They can be less durable than steel but are more affordable, typically costing between $700 and $2,500. Many aluminum doors also feature glass panels for a sleek, modern look.

Fiberglass Garage Doors

Fiberglass doors mimic the appearance of wood but are less susceptible to warping or rotting. They are a durable, low-maintenance option, but they can be more expensive, with prices generally ranging from $1,500 to $3,500.

Insulation

Adding insulation to your garage door helps regulate the temperature inside the garage, making it more energy-efficient and comfortable. Insulated garage doors are especially beneficial for attached garages, as they help reduce heating and cooling costs for adjacent rooms.

  • Non-insulated garage doors are the least expensive, typically costing between $500 and $1,500.

  • Insulated garage doors provide better energy efficiency and can cost between $800 and $3,500, depending on the material and type of insulation.

Size of the Garage Door

The size of the door is another major factor in determining the new garage door cost. Standard garage doors come in single-car and double-car sizes, with custom sizes available for larger garages.

  • Single-car garage doors typically measure 8 to 9 feet wide and 7 to 8 feet tall. The cost for these doors ranges from $500 to $2,500, depending on the material and insulation.

  • Double-car garage doors measure around 16 feet wide and 7 to 8 feet tall, costing between $1,000 and $4,000, depending on the material and features.

Customization and Design Options

Customizing your garage door with unique designs, finishes, or windows can increase the overall cost. Some homeowners choose to add decorative hardware, intricate patterns, or glass panels to enhance curb appeal. While these options can boost the visual impact of your garage door, they also come with higher price tags.

  • Windows can add between $200 and $500 to the overall cost, depending on size and style.

  • Decorative hardware like handles, hinges, or ornamental features can add another $50 to $300.

Garage Door Opener and Accessories

A garage door opener is an essential component of your garage door system, providing the convenience of remote access. The type of opener you choose will impact the total cost of your new garage door installation.

  • Chain-drive openers are the most affordable option but tend to be noisier. Prices range from $150 to $300.

  • Belt-drive openers are quieter and more durable, typically costing between $200 and $500.

  • Screw-drive openers are a low-maintenance option, with prices ranging from $200 to $400.

  • Smart garage door openers allow for remote control and monitoring via smartphone apps, costing between $300 and $700.

Labor and Installation Costs

The cost of labor for garage door installation in West Covina depends on the complexity of the job and the type of door being installed. Most professional installations will cost between $200 and $600 for a standard garage door.

Factors Influencing Installation Costs

  • Removing old doors: If you’re replacing an existing garage door, there may be an additional charge for removing and disposing of the old door, typically costing between $50 and $150.

  • Modifications to the garage: If the garage structure requires modifications to accommodate a new door or opener, this can add to the labor costs. Custom-sized doors may also require additional framing or adjustments.

  • Electrical work: If you’re installing a new garage door opener that requires electrical wiring, you may need to hire an electrician. Electrical work can add another $100 to $200 to the total cost.

Common FAQs About New Garage Door Cost

1. How much does a new garage door cost in West Covina, California?

The cost of a new garage door in West Covina can vary greatly depending on several factors. On average, you can expect to pay anywhere from $500 to $4,000. Here’s a breakdown of some factors influencing the cost:

  • Material: Steel, aluminum, wood, and fiberglass are common options. Steel is more affordable, while custom wooden doors can be on the higher end.

  • Size: Standard single-car garage doors are typically less expensive than double-car garage doors.

  • Insulation: Insulated doors cost more but offer energy efficiency benefits, especially for garages attached to living spaces.

  • Customization: Custom colors, windows, or unique finishes can drive up the price.

  • Installation: Professional installation typically costs between $200 to $600, depending on the complexity of the installation and whether the old door needs to be removed.

2. Are insulated garage doors worth the extra cost?

Yes, in many cases, insulated garage doors are worth the extra investment, especially for homes with attached garages. Key benefits include:

  • Energy Efficiency: Insulated doors help maintain a stable temperature inside the garage, reducing the amount of energy needed to heat or cool the space. This can lead to lower energy bills.

  • Noise Reduction: Insulated doors tend to be quieter when opening and closing compared to non-insulated doors, making them ideal if your garage is near living spaces or bedrooms.

  • Durability: Insulated doors often have added layers of protection, making them more resistant to dents and wear.

  • Comfort: If you use your garage as a workspace, gym, or storage area, insulation can help keep it comfortable year-round.

3. Can I install a new garage door myself to save on labor costs?

While DIY garage door installation might seem like a good way to save on labor costs, it is generally not recommended unless you have previous experience and the necessary tools. Here’s why:

  • Safety Risks: Garage doors are heavy and operate under tension. Mishandling the springs or misaligning tracks can lead to serious injury or damage.

  • Voiding Warranties: Many garage door manufacturers void their warranties if the door is not installed by a licensed professional.

  • Precision Required: A properly installed garage door must be perfectly balanced to function smoothly. Even a minor misalignment can cause operational issues or shorten the lifespan of the door.

For most homeowners, hiring a professional installer ensures that the door is installed safely and meets warranty requirements.

4. What factors should I consider when choosing a new garage door?

When selecting a new garage door, several factors come into play to ensure you get the right door for your home:

  • Material: Steel, aluminum, wood, fiberglass, and vinyl are common materials. Each has its pros and cons in terms of durability, maintenance, and aesthetics.

  • Insulation: Insulated doors offer better energy efficiency and can improve comfort, especially if your garage is attached to your home.

  • Design & Style: Choose a design that complements your home’s exterior. From traditional raised panels to modern designs with windows, there are many options available.

  • Size: Make sure to choose the right size for your garage, especially if you’re upgrading from a single to a double door or vice versa.

  • Durability: Consider how much wear and tear your garage door will experience. If you live in an area prone to harsh weather, you may need a more durable, weather-resistant material.

  • Maintenance: Some materials, like wood, require more upkeep than others, such as steel or aluminum.

  • Budget: Determine how much you’re willing to spend upfront and factor in potential long-term costs, like maintenance and energy savings from insulation.

Consulting a garage door professional can help you weigh these factors and choose the best door for your home.

5. How long do garage doors typically last?

Garage doors typically last between 15 and 30 years, depending on several factors:

  • Material: Wood doors may require more maintenance but can last longer if properly cared for. Steel doors are durable but may need protection against rust.

  • Installation Quality: A professionally installed garage door will function better and last longer than one installed incorrectly.

  • Maintenance: Regular maintenance, such as lubricating moving parts, inspecting hardware, and adjusting the door balance, can significantly extend the door’s lifespan.

  • Usage: The frequency of use affects longevity. A garage door that is opened and closed multiple times a day may wear out faster than one used occasionally.
